Superior Ergonomic Seating for Increased Efficiency

Boosting productivity in the workplace has become a top priority for businesses. One factor contributing to this is providing employees with comfortable and supportive seating options. Specifically designed chairs are gaining popularity due to their ability to promote proper posture, reduce strain on the body, and increase overall comfort.

These chairs integrate adjustable settings to ensure a comfortable fit for users of all heights. Moreover, they often include lumbar support, headrests, and support arms to alleviate pressure on the back, neck, and shoulders. The result is a improved sense of well-being, leading to increased focus and productivity. Studies have shown that employees who use ergonomic chairs experience less aches and pains, resulting in higher job satisfaction and a decreased risk of workplace injuries.
